Output cc589564e417880aff55f2f365812760bbbae2b5efc0eb265acf8ded9049989f:0

value
72693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 107f342c570aacfedc77d94bb3bbe758920d72d1 OP_EQUAL
address
33CF7tTtPjQAvxAcFiZHbLi8CxosZq2joF
transaction
cc589564e417880aff55f2f365812760bbbae2b5efc0eb265acf8ded9049989f